According to 6Wresearch internal database and industry insights, the Global Phosgene Market was valued at USD 4.2 Billion in 2024 and is expected to reach USD 5.85 Billion by 2031, growing at a compound annual growth rate of 4.60% during the forecast period (2025-2031).
The global phosgene market is primarily driven by its widespread application in the production of various chemicals, such as isocyanates, polycarbonates, and pesticides. The increasing demand for these chemicals in industries like automotive, construction, agriculture, and electronics fuels the growth of the phosgene market. Asia-Pacific region dominates the market due to rapid industrialization and the presence of key players in countries like China and India. However, stringent regulations regarding the handling and transportation of phosgene pose a challenge to market growth. The market is also witnessing a shift towards sustainable and eco-friendly alternatives, which could impact the demand for phosgene in the coming years. Overall, the global phosgene market is expected to continue growing, driven by the expanding chemical industry and technological advancements.

The global phosgene market is primarily driven by the increasing demand for isocyanates, which are key raw materials in the production of polyurethanes. The growth of industries such as construction, automotive, and electronics, coupled with the rising need for insulation materials, adhesives, and coatings, is driving the demand for polyurethanes, thus boosting the market for phosgene. Additionally, the growing use of phosgene in the production of various chemicals such as polycarbonates, agrochemicals, and pharmaceuticals is further contributing to market growth. The expanding manufacturing sector in emerging economies, technological advancements in phosgene production processes, and the rising adoption of sustainable practices are also key factors fueling the global phosgene market.
